Southern Maine Sweeps Mass. Maritime and Curry

            BUZZARDS BAY, Mass. -- The undefeated University of Southern Maine women's volleyball team extended its season-opening winning streak to five on Saturday sweeping Massachusetts Maritime Academy and Curry College in a non-conference tri-match played at MMA's Clean Harbors Athletic Center.

            The Huskies (5-0) dispatch with the host Buccaneers (0-3) in the opening match in three sets, 25-8, 25-3 and 25-7.  After the break, the Huskies came back to defeat to the Colonels in straight sets, 25-19, 25-16 and 25-14.  The Colonels downed the Buccaneers in the final match 25-20, 25-20, 25-20.

            First-year outside hitters Jessica Williamson (Goffstown, N.H.) and Monica Raymond (Sanbornton, N.H./Winnisquam) combined for 23 kills and 14 digs in the opening match against MMA.  Williamson led the attack with 13 kills and had 10 digs while Raymond complemented Williamson with 10 kills and four digs.  Sophomore setter Megan Nilson (Granby, Conn.) ran the offense with 24 assists, and junior libero Demi Ruder (Grand Junction, Colo.) had 17 digs.  Sophomore Karina Zellou (Marshfield, Maine) served up nine aces.

            Against Curry, Williamson came up with 21 kills and 14 digs as the Huskies prevailed in three straight.  Raymond added eight kills, and junior Renee Trottier (Biddeford, Maine) chipped in with seven kills.  Nilson dished out 35 assists and had 10 digs.  Ruder also contributed 10 digs.

            Southern Maine returns to the court tomorrow (11:00 a.m.) hosting a non-conference tri-match at the Warren Hill Gymnasium against the University of Maine Presque Isle and Castleton State College.
